+PyDoc_STRVAR(builtin___import____doc__,
+"__import__($module, /, name, globals=None, locals=None, fromlist=(),\n"
+" level=0)\n"
+"--\n"
+"\n"
+"Import a module.\n"
+"\n"
+"Because this function is meant for use by the Python\n"
+"interpreter and not for general use, it is better to use\n"
+"importlib.import_module() to programmatically import a module.\n"
+"\n"
+"The globals argument is only used to determine the context;\n"
+"they are not modified. The locals argument is unused. The fromlist\n"
+"should be a list of names to emulate ``from name import ...\'\', or an\n"
+"empty list to emulate ``import name\'\'.\n"
+"When importing a module from a package, note that __import__(\'A.B\', ...)\n"
+"returns package A when fromlist is empty, but its submodule B when\n"
+"fromlist is not empty. The level argument is used to determine whether to\n"
+"perform absolute or relative imports: 0 is absolute, while a positive number\n"
+"is the number of parent directories to search relative to the current module.");
